Career Advancement Programme in Dyskinesia
-- ViewingNowThe Career Advancement Programme in Dyskinesia is a comprehensive certificate course designed to equip learners with essential skills in managing and understanding dyskinesia, a common side effect of long-term Parkinson's disease treatment. This program is critical for healthcare professionals seeking to enhance their knowledge and skills in movement disorder management.
